He watched intently, still and silent, tracing the smallest movement with his eyes. The rise and fall was slow and slight, but he was sure it was there, as sure as he could be in the diminishing light, as the embers of the fire receded to little more than a glow.



There it was again, an only just perceivable fluctuation. His eyes began to sting with the strain of looking. Blinking away the dryness, he continued watching. That was all he could do. Watch the movement, watch and hope that he could still see it and that it didn't stop.
